Jasper suffered their closest loss since November 11, 2023 on Tuesday. They fell just short of the Washington Hatchets by a score of 59-57. The Wildcats haven't had much luck with the Hatchets recently, as the team's come up short the last four times they've met.
Washington's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Katie Reed, who went 8 for 16 on her way to 17 points in addition to six rebounds and four steals. Reed is on a roll when it comes to steals, as she's now grabbed two or more in the last three games she's played. The team also got some help courtesy of Aubrey Frank, who posted 15 points along with five assists and five boards.
Jasper's defeat dropped their record down to 5-5. As for Washington, the win (which was their ninth in a row) raised their record to 11-2.
